Biography

I am living a dream . . . Forever, I have had a passion for painting and drawing, with a fondness for all types of animals – especially dogs. A life-long dog owner and lover, creating unique portraits of our four-legged best friends is one of my specialties. I love the feeling of joy that owners experience when they are presented with a completed portrait of their pet.

It was a long road to reach my dream of becoming a full-time fine artist. Originally from Cleveland, I broke away from an environment that did not encourage me to be thoughtful, creative or pursue higher learning. I was formally educated at the Cooper School of Art. Out of school, I worked in publishing, advertising, and commercial art involving small companies to large corporations. When computers changed the world of commercial art, I decided to change careers by earning my BSN and worked as a registered nurse.

Life changed dramatically when my husband passed away at an early age. With my son and two dogs in tow I moved to the desert of Southern California and worked in a variety of nursing jobs, drawing and painting as time allowed. After another life changing event, my gypsy spirit kicked in and I moved to Sarasota on the Gulf Coast of Florida where I landed more jobs in nursing and dreamed of painting full time. When I unexpectedly met a guy who whisked me away to Melbourne on the Atlantic Coast, I decided to leave the nursing profession to pursue my dream. Wally the dog is the other guy in my life.
